160,000-year-old fossilized skulls from Ethiopia are oldest modern humans

Berkeley -The fossilized skulls of two adults and one child discovered in the Afar region of eastern Ethiopia have been dated at 160,000 years, making them the oldest known fossils of modern humans, or Homo sapiens....... Rabies vaccinations could help save Ethiopian wolf

Without action, rabies spread by dogs might wipe out the 500 remaining Ethiopian wolves. But new research shows that vaccinating a fraction of the wolves could protect this critically endangered species from rabies epidemics....... Earliest human ancestors discovered in Ethiopia

...Discovery of bones and teeth date fossils back more than 5.2 million years ... ...Anthropologists have discovered the remains of the earliest known human ancestor in Ethiopia, dating to between 5.2 and 5.8 million years ago and which predate the previously oldest-known fossils by almost a million years.
